We are seeking an experienced, team-oriented Registered Veterinary Nurse to join our team at Easipetcare on a full-time basis. Easipetcare Streatham is a well-established practice in the heart of busy South London, with excellent transport links and a loyal, long-standing client base. The clinic benefits from a consistent and varied caseload, giving the team exposure to everything from routine appointments to more complex medical and surgical cases. The practice is fully equipped with ultrasound, digital x-ray, dental equipment, an in-house lab, three consulting rooms, a dedicated theatre and prep area, plus separate cat ward facilities - creating a well-supported clinical environment where high standards of patient care come first.

You’ll be joining a friendly, collaborative team that genuinely enjoys working together. Alongside an experienced Senior Vet, the practice is supported by a dedicated reception team, a full-time student nurse, a placement student, and a Veterinary Care Assistant, with an additional student vet joining in September. Nurses are encouraged to fully utilise their skills across consulting, theatre, inpatient care, and schedule management, with a strong focus on teamwork, communication, and efficiency throughout the day.

How You’ll Make a Difference

As a Registered Veterinary Nurse, you will be an integral member of the clinical team, delivering high-quality nursing care to patients while supporting excellent client experiences. You’ll work collaboratively with veterinary surgeons and the wider practice team, taking responsibility for the nursing care of a range of first opinion cases, contributing to clinical standards, and supporting the ongoing development of patient care within the practice.

This is a full-time position working 40 hours per week, with flexibility to work across 4 days or 5 days between 8 am and 6:30 pm. There are no weekends or OOH.

General responsibilities include:

  • General nurse admin
  • Consults
  • Procedures such as neutering and dentals
  • Cleaning
  • Clinic orders
